Scottish Fold cats, like all domestic cats, experience a reproductive cycle that includes a period known as estrus, or "heat." During this time, female Scottish Folds become receptive to mating, and their behavior may change noticeably. The duration of estrus varies but typically lasts between 4 to 7 days. If mating does not occur, the cat may go through multiple estrus cycles, often every 2 to 3 weeks, until she becomes pregnant or the breeding season ends. Male Scottish Folds, on the other hand, do not have a specific "walking" period but are generally ready to mate whenever they detect a female in heat. It’s important to note that responsible breeding practices should always be followed, and spaying or neutering is recommended for cats not intended for breeding to prevent unwanted litters and promote their overall health. Understanding the reproductive cycle of Scottish Folds is essential for cat owners to ensure proper care and management of their pets.
